Wolf Dancer Kachina is a significant figure in Navajo mythology and culture. Kachinas are spiritual beings in the Native American Pueblo cultures, and they play important roles in religious ceremonies and social events. Each kachina represents a specific natural or supernatural force, animal, or element. The Wolf Kachina holds a special meaning within Navajo tradition. Wolves are revered as powerful and intelligent creatures, symbolizing loyalty, guardianship, and survival skills. The Wolf Kachina embodies these qualities and serves as a spiritual guide for the Navajo people.
